Late one night, I received a phone call from Bro. Magadaire, a preacher at Machongwe Church of Christ in Chimanimani and chairman of the MGM team. He was in Bazel, accompanied by a local policeman. Bro. Magadaire had traveled to Bazel to pay a fine following a car accident.
The accident occurred when Bro. Magadaire was driving behind a truck and a small car. Suddenly, cattle appeared on the road, and as he attempted to overtake, additional vehicles were approaching on the highway, which has only one lane. He collided with the car behind him. As a result, he was required to pay $1,200 for car repairs and a $100 police fine.
I provided Bro. Magadaire with shelter that night. Thankfully, no one was injured, and there were no fatalities. Bro. Magadaire expressed his gratitude for the warm hospitality extended by my wife.
